Texas, 1980. Walton City has fallen to a zombie outbreak. Lead a band of desperate survivors from refuge to refuge by scavenging, crafting, and fighting in a relentless struggle for survival. Plan wisely, stick together, and — above all — keep moving if you want to make it out alive.

Into the Dead: Our Darkest Days is a early access, survival and zombies game developed by PikPok and published by PikPok and Boltray Games.
Released on April 09th 2025 is available on Windows and MacOS in 10 languages: English, Simplified Chinese, French, German, Spanish - Spain, Korean, Portuguese - Brazil, Russian, Italian and Traditional Chinese.

It has received 873 reviews of which 656 were positive and 217 were negative resulting in a rating of 7.2 out of 10. 😊

The game is currently priced at 24.99€ on Steam.

The people complaining about low weapon durability and item "scarcity" are the same people that will complain about Balatro or Slay the Spire having "too much RNG" - they simply do not play games like this the way the game wants you to play it. Fact is, every "problem" you'll read in 99% of these negative comments is quite literally user error. The game doesn't expect you to kill every zombie - it has designed levels in a way that expects you to take advantage of hiding spots, door pathing and dead ends to move around zombies quietly and manipulate their patrolling to be avoidable. Anyone complaining about them being "stronger than you" is objectively wrong - you can kill any zombie with your bare hands. That being said, you'd obviously prefer NOT to do this and if you get crowds on you, you're dead if you don't run; but remember - you are SMARTER than they are. You can intentionally kite them off ledges, lure them via sound in to areas you want to move them to, even break down barriers prematurely before exploring the full zone by utilizing sound to anger them in to breaking it for you. The levels are like puzzles, this is not Left 4 Dead. You aren't expected to be a zombie murder hobo. Resources are tight but as you find more survivors you can skillfully juggle resource expeditions with base tending - be smart and send your fighters and scouts out to clear and prep zones, send your bigger backpack guys to clean up afterwards. Many of these POIs are not one-trip spots, plan for multiple visits. Weapon durability is an early game issue - once you unlock higher tier weapon crafting, you will be able to craft weapons that can KO many many zombies in a single relatively cheap craft. The game is a very well designed balance of challenge and reward, just make sure you are maximizing your time efficiently and map out where you find survivors for future runs. As you get better and better at finding them quicker in subsequent runs (they are static in their POI locations) you will be covering more ground quicker and quicker and have a solid resource supply in no time.
